Javascript 用于重新启动调用进程的NodeJS命令

Javascript 用于重新启动调用进程的NodeJS命令,javascript,node.js,Javascript,Node.js,是否有命令强制调用进程重新启动自身?我有一个查询数据库的进程,我只想在某些事件发生时重新开始 您可以使用NodeJ的supervisor模块,该模块将持续监视您的应用程序。 您可以使用以下命令安装它: sudo npm install supervisor -g 从命令行执行此操作后,只需说 sudo supervisor app.js 现在,您的应用程序将被监控,一旦应用程序退出,它将再次重新启动一个新的应用程序。Supervisor还监视您的完整文件夹结构,每当文件发生更改时,它将再次重

是否有命令强制调用进程重新启动自身?我有一个查询数据库的进程,我只想在某些事件发生时重新开始

您可以使用NodeJ的supervisor模块,该模块将持续监视您的应用程序。 您可以使用以下命令安装它:

sudo npm install supervisor -g
从命令行执行此操作后,只需说

sudo supervisor app.js
现在,您的应用程序将被监控,一旦应用程序退出,它将再次重新启动一个新的应用程序。Supervisor还监视您的完整文件夹结构,每当文件发生更改时,它将再次重新启动应用程序


要退出脚本,可以使用
process.exit()按要求…

对不起。你能详细说明一下你的问题吗?我想你的意思是重置请求并像重新启动一样执行应用程序?为什么你不能让这个过程成为一个导出的函数,而不是从任何事件调用它?同样如上所述,你真的需要用例子来说明你的问题,因为这可能是一百万个其他类似问题的子集。这是基于节点代码中的事件吗?这是服务器事件吗。。etc@PetarVasilev是的,这正是我想要的mean@AndrewFont这在node.js服务器代码中。我试图做的不是作为一个函数,而是需要一个单独的过程。